Our Finance team assists clients in building Finance functions that are business-focused, cost-effective and agile in meeting the needs of all their stakeholders.
These offerings include: Agile Business Finance
- Delivering an optimised Finance function by ensuring a collaborative alignment between Finance, Business and Technology to build an Innovation-led Finance function to help empower teams, enhance capabilities and realise benefits faster.
Value and Performance Management
- Enabling Finance functions to identify and deliver sustainable long term value through optimised planning, reporting and analytics.
Global Business Services
- Developing high performing operating models through process simplification, standardisation and leveraging enabling technologies.
Finance Strategy and Operating Model
- Development of a digital finance vision; target operating model; case for change, benefits realisation and transformation roadmap.
Key to many of our Finance Transformation engagements is the identification, evaluation and deployment of the right technology to support our clients' business agenda.
In particular, this involves intertwining our Finance and Shared Services portfolio with other offerings like cyber security, analytics, RPA and digital technologies.
